Bug Description

Upgrading from 10.04 desktop to 10.10 causes the Xserver to crash because the fglrx driver is not compatible with xserver 1.9.

Launchpad Janitor (janitor) wrote :

This bug was fixed in the package fglrx-installer - 2:8.780-0ubuntu1

---------------
fglrx-installer (2:8.780-0ubuntu1) maverick; urgency=low

  * New upstream release.
    - Fix build issues with kernel fix for CVE-2010-3081 (LP: #642518).
    - Add compatibility with 2.6.35 kernels (LP: #573748).
    - Add compatibility with xserver 1.9 (LP: #630599).
  * Make the driver Depend on the appropriate xserver-xorg-video-$ABI
    (LP: #616215).
 -- Alberto Milone <email address hidden> Wed, 22 Sep 2010 18:28:32 +0200
